Leveraging Web Scraping for Social Media Data Analysis
Businesses and researchers are increasingly turning to web scraping as a powerful method for gathering valuable information from social media platforms. This automated data extraction technique provides access to a wealth of publicly available content, including posts, comments, user profiles, hashtags, and engagement metrics.
From a data measurement perspective, web scraping serves as an effective collection method that enables systematic sampling and analysis of social media content. When standard APIs have limitations or restrictions, scraping tools can interact directly with social media websites to retrieve otherwise inaccessible data.
Targeted Data Collection
One of the key advantages of web scraping is the ability to target specific data points. Organizations can collect posts within precise date ranges, from particular user accounts, or related to specific hashtags. This focused approach ensures that data collection aligns with specific research or business objectives.
Advanced scraping tools are equipped to handle dynamic content loading, which is particularly common on social media platforms where content updates in real time as users interact with the site. Through techniques like browser automation that mimic human browsing behavior, these tools can access dynamically loaded data.
Data Processing and Applications
After extraction, scraped data typically requires parsing and cleaning to convert it into structured formats suitable for analysis. This process can be accomplished using various data manipulation libraries or software solutions.
The practical applications of social media web scraping are diverse and powerful:
- Sentiment Analysis: Extracted posts and comments can be analyzed to measure public sentiment toward brands, products, or events.
- Market Research: Scraped data helps identify trends, consumer preferences, and competitor activities by sampling large datasets from social media conversations.
- Social Network Analysis: User interaction data can reveal network structures, influence patterns, and information spread dynamics.
- Content Monitoring: Organizations can track the frequency and reach of specific topics or hashtags to quantify engagement and public interest.
- Behavioral Pattern Analysis: Researchers can sample social media behavior patterns over time to measure changes in public opinion or social dynamics.
The Importance of Sampling
Given the massive volume of data generated continuously across social media platforms, sampling is essential. Web scraping enables systematic sampling by filtering data based on time frames, keywords, or user demographics, making the data both manageable and relevant for specific measurement goals.
In conclusion, web scraping provides a robust framework for the measurement and analysis of social media content. By extracting structured data from these platforms, organizations can quantify user behavior, monitor trends, and support informed decision-making processes across various fields including research, marketing, and social sciences.